New Stockton manager Easterlow brings in Easterlow number two

New Stockton manager Scott Easterlow has gone for a familiar face to help him bring about an instant return to the Coventry Alliance Premier.

Stockton finished rock-bottom in the top flight last season, prompting them to appoint Easterlow in June and he will be joined at Town Piece by his dad Marcus, who will act as his number two.

Goalkeeping coach Dave Moreton is also coming in alongside the former Alveston manager and Scott says the duo will provide valuable support.

“The structure around the team is as important as the players, hence why I brought in Dave and my dad,” said Easterlow, who guided Whitnash Reserves to the Division Three title last season.

“At a lot of the teams I’ve played at over the years there were never any special measures taken to help the goalkeeper and, of all the roles in a team, that’s arguably the most important so Dave is a massive plus for us as a team.

“In convincing my dad to come out of retirement I have brought in someone who I know will be committed week-in, week-out and I trust 100 per cent.

“Also, he is one of the only people I know who looks more into the details of game preparation and analysis than I do.”

 Kenilworth Wardens return to pre-season training on Tuesday (6.30pm).

Following a second promotion in two years, Wardens’ senior team are preparing for their maiden Coventry Alliance Premier Division campaign, while the reserves will play in Division Three.

Wardens are are looking to strengthen on and off the pitch, with new players and volunteers being sought.
